New Richmond Area Off Leash Dog Park

Overview: New Richmond Area Off Leash Dog Park is rated 4.7/5 from 115 Google reviews. Reviews most often describe it as clean and well kept and spacious with room for dogs to run. Amenities: Reviewers often mention secure fencing and separate dog areas, poop bags, seating, and other park extras, and shade and tree cover. Crowd: Reviews describe regular visitors and active use, a friendly crowd of owners and dogs, and steady activity with other dogs to meet. Downsides: Some reviews mention inconsistent cleanliness.

Jennifer Fawkes7 months ago

Very large dog park. Multiple benches throughout the dog park. Picnic pavilion and water pump. Also a smaller fenced in area for use. 1 lap around the large dog area is about 1200 steps. Poop bags are available at the entrance.

Kitt Mattison9 months ago

It's always relaxing to walk here with my pup. We have so much fun. 99% of the other dogs are friendly. Last week we made friends with this adorable husky.

Jorden Aufderhar4 years ago

Having been to several local dog parks, I feel safe in saying New Richmond's is a cut above. Two separate fenced in areas allow for the separation of dogs if needed and everyone I've met has been super friendly. There is also a large pavilion with tables and a few benches and trash can scattered about. A few negatives include the lack of running water, trees in the main areas, and a paved lot but overall the large fenced space makes this park an asset to NR dog owners.

Melanie Talavera10 months ago

There's a $3 daily usage fee.... The one I was in is about a mile to walk around, I'm guessing the other one is much smaller. It is fenced in, but there's no way your dog would know that. Nice for my girl to stretch her little legs... I was the only one there at that time, but there's a big covered sitting area for everyone if it should ever get busy...

Nathan Harta year ago

I love our local dog park. I wish they had a couple more covered seating areas but overall it’s a large area to let your pup run around. There’s a smaller area for the smaller breeds as well. Most owners are conscientious about cleaning up their dog’s piles. It would be nice if everyone was! About 3 laps is a mile FYI.
